Project Manager- Revenue Cycle Duration: 12 months ABOUT THE ROLE Our client is seeking an experienced Project Manager to oversee and coordinate IT initiatives within the healthcare sector, with a specific focus on Revenue Cycle solutions. This 12-month contract role requires managing complex projects from inception to completion, developing and maintaining detailed project schedules and Work Breakdown Structures (WBS), and ensuring alignment with organizational goals and timelines. The Project Manager will be responsible for tracking project progress, managing scope, budget, resources, and risks, and facilitating effective communication among stakeholders, including internal teams, third-party vendors, and managed service partners. The ideal candidate will have proven experience in Healthcare IT project management, hands-on knowledge of Revenue Cycle systems such as Epic Hospital or Physician billing, strong problem-solving skills, and excellent communication abilities. A bachelor's degree is required, preferably in a technical discipline, and PMI or PMP certification is strongly preferred.
